Movie rating: 6.7 / 10 ( 6804 ) Directed by: Pierre Souvestre - André Hunebelle - Marcel Allain - Jean Halain WebApr 20, 2024 · The plot of Fantomas vs. Scotland Yard takes place in the Scottish castle of the mysterious Lord Mac Rashley (Jean-Roger Caussimon). However, you don’t have to go all the way to Scotland to discover the sumptuous house. Lord Mac Rashley’s castle is located in Gironde. The castle of Roquetaillade lent its facade for the needs of the shooting. road trip en grece
